Prithvi Shaw smashes fastest fifty of IPL 2021, hits 6 fours in one over

Delhi Capitals opening batsman Prithvi Shaw on Thursday smashed the fastest fifty of IPL 2021. The youngster brought up his half-century off just 18 balls. In his innings, Shaw smashed 9 fours and a six. He overtook Punjab Kings’ allrounder Deepak Hooda who had achieved the feat in just 20 balls.

Shaw also became the joint second-fastest half-century scorer for DC. Shaw also shared a partnership of fifty runs with Shikhar Dhawan to provide a top start for the Delhi Capitals. In the match, Shaw went on to score 82 runs at a strike rate of 200. He struck 11 fours and 3 sixes. Earlier in the innings, Shaw joined a unique list as he hit six fours in the first over of his team’s run chase and became the second batsman after teammate Ajinkya Rahane to achieve this feat in the IPL. He also struck back to back boundaries of all the deliveries bowled by Shivam Mavi in the opening over against KKR. With his knock of 82, Prithvi Shaw also has entered top 3 of ORANGE Cap Leaderboard. Shaw now has 269 runs @ strike rate of 165.03 and is currently in a 3rd position.
